Can anyone tell me - is there an address location that tells the ecu to look for the A9 pin, 12 volt input that causes it to switch between gas and petrol? Is that how it works?

Yes 12v applied to A9 Petrol Mode, no voltage LPG mode.

Also Check the PCM Serial Numbers, For Example

86145855S551110143

55111 Component, 55110 is the minimum, under this it will not run a LPG tune.

There is a parameter in the cal, for $76 it is at 0x382E mask 0x01
1= LPG capable, 0= not LPG capable

Code 31 is no VATS from the (missing) BCM, disable VATS and your good to go on petrol - its just that the injectors are not being enabled.
